Output 622e2a96d11a1de3940828ab7c10574d83982fd8620b625efb8e7ceb3aefa237:0

value
91016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c1f5ff9ce3616e08d73f9c906138c444835908 OP_EQUAL
address
3MBGD3b3xt4DmsvLUySMT3iynQdDnTvNHa
transaction
622e2a96d11a1de3940828ab7c10574d83982fd8620b625efb8e7ceb3aefa237
spent
true